Pengali biner: Perbedaan antara revisi

Konten dihapus Konten ditambahkan
Zɛphyɻ (bicara | kontrib)
←Membuat halaman berisi ''''Pengali''' atau '''Multiplier''' adalah rangkaian elektronika digital yang berada dalam berbagai perangkat elektronik seperti komputer yang berfungsi untuk mengalikan dua buah bilangan dalam sistem bilangan biner, dwi-an atau basis 2. Jenis rangkaian ini biasanya merupakan bagian dari {{Tooltip|ALU|ALU (Arithmetic Logic Unit) adalah komponen dalam prosesor yang bertanggung jawab unt...'
Tag: kemungkinan perlu dirapikan tidak menyebut judul [ * ] VisualEditor-alih
 
Zɛphyɻ (bicara | kontrib)
menambah referensi
 
Baris 2:
 
== Sejarah ==
Antara tahun 1947 dan 1949, Arthur Alec Robinson bekerja untuk [[English Electric Company Limited|English Electric]] , sebagai mahasiswa magang, dan kemudian sebagai insinyur pengembangan. Yang terpenting selama periode ini ia belajar untuk gelar PhD di [[Universitas Manchester]], di mana ia bekerja sebagai desainer sirkuit untuk pengali keras [[komputer Mark 1]] lawas . Namun, hingga akhir tahun 1970-an, sebagian besar [[komputer mini]] tidak memiliki instruksi perkalian, sehingga programmer menggunakan "perkalian rutin"<ref>{{cite  yangbook berulang|last1=Rather kali|first1=Elizabeth menggeserD. dan|last2=Colburn mengumpulkan|first2=Donald hasilR. parsial,|last3=Moore sering|first3=Charles kaliH. ditulis|title=History menggunakanof pelepasanprogramming looplanguages---II |chapter=The evolution of Forth |chapter-url=http://www.forth.com/resources/evolution/index.html [[Komputer|editor-first=Thomas bingkaiJ. utama]]|editor-last=Bergin memiliki|editor2-first=Richard instruksiG. perkalian,|editor2-last=Gibson tetapi|publisher=Association merekafor melakukanComputing jenisMachinery pergeseran|date=1996 dan|isbn=0201895021 penambahan|pages=625–670 yang|doi=10.1145/234286.1057832 sama|orig-year=1993}}</ref><ref>{{cite sebagaijournal "perkalian|doi=10.1016/0308-5953(77)90004-6 rutin"|title=Interfacing a hardware multiplier to a general-purpose microprocessor |first1=A.C. |last1=Davies |first2=Y.T. |last2=Fung |journal=Microprocessors
|volume=1 |issue=7 |year=1977 |pages=425–432 |url=https://dx.doi.org/10.1016/0308-5953%2877%2990004-6 }}</ref><ref>{{cite book
| title = Fundamentals of Digital Logic and Microcomputer Design
| first = M. |last=Rafiquzzaman
| author-link = Mohamed Rafiquzzaman
| publisher = [[John Wiley & Sons|Wiley]]
| page = 46
| year = 2005
| isbn = 978-0-47173349-2 |chapter=§2.5.1 Binary Arithmetic: Multiplication of Unsigned Binary Numbers
| chapter-url = {{GBurl|1QZEawDm9uAC|p=46}}}}</ref>  yang berulang kali menggeser dan mengumpulkan hasil parsial, sering kali ditulis menggunakan pelepasan loop . [[Komputer bingkai utama]] memiliki instruksi perkalian, tetapi mereka melakukan jenis pergeseran dan penambahan yang sama sebagai "perkalian rutin".
 
[[Mikroprosesor]] lawas juga tidak memiliki instruksi perkalian. Meskipun instruksi perkalian menjadi umum dengan generasi 16-bit, <ref>{{harvnb|Rafiquzzaman|2005|loc=[{{GBurl|1QZEawDm9uAC|p=251}} §7.3.3 Addition, Subtraction, Multiplication and Division of Signed and Unsigned Numbers p. 251]}}</ref> setidaknya dua prosesor 8-bit memiliki instruksi perkalian: Motorola 6809 , diperkenalkan pada tahun 1978,<ref>{{cite  dan keluarga [[Intel MCS-51]] , dikembangkan pada tahun 1980, dan kemudian mikroprosesor [[Atmel AVR]] 8-bit modern yang ada di [[Pengendali mikro|pengandali mikro]] ATMega, ATTiny dan ATXMega.book
| title = Microprocessors and Microcontrollers: Architecture, Programming and System Design 8085, 8086, 8051, 8096
| first = Krishna |last=Kant
| publisher = PHI Learning
| page = 57
| year = 2007
| isbn = 9788120331914 |chapter=§2.11.2 16-Bit Microprocessors
| chapter-url = {{GBurl|P-n3kelycHQC|p=57}}
}}</ref>  dan keluarga [[Intel MCS-51]] , dikembangkan pada tahun 1980, dan kemudian mikroprosesor [[Atmel AVR]] 8-bit modern yang ada di [[Pengendali mikro|pengandali mikro]] ATMega, ATTiny dan ATXMega.
 
Karena lebih banyak transistor per cip yang tersedia karena integrasi berskala lebih besar, menjadi mungkin untuk menempatkan cukup banyak penjumlah pada satu chip untuk menjumlahkan semua produk parsial sekaligus, daripada menggunakan kembali satu penjumlah untuk menangani setiap produk parsial satu per satu.